""A Collection of the Familiar Letters and Miscellaneous Papers of Benjamin Franklin: Now for the First Time Published"" is a book that was first published in 1833. The book is a compilation of letters and papers written by one of America's founding fathers, Benjamin Franklin. These letters and papers were previously unpublished, and this book provides readers with a glimpse into the personal and professional life of one of the most influential figures in American history. The letters cover a wide range of topics, including politics, science, and personal relationships.
